glimpse [ ɡlimps ]

  • n.
    • a quick look

      同义词: glance coup d'oeil

    • a brief or incomplete view

      "from the window he could catch a glimpse of the lake"

    • a vague indication

      "he caught only a glimpse of the professor's meaning"

  • v. catch a glimpse of or see briefly

    "We glimpsed the Queen as she got into her limousine"
